שילוב של Liftoff Monetize עם תהליך בחירת הרשת (Mediation)

במדריך הזה מוסבר איך להשתמש ב-Google Mobile Ads SDK כדי לטעון ולהציג מודעות מ-Liftoff Monetize באמצעות תהליך בחירת הרשת (Mediation), שכולל גם שילובים של בידינג וגם שילובים ב-Waterfall. נסביר איך להוסיף את Liftoff Monetize להגדרת תהליך בחירת הרשת (Mediation) של יחידת מודעות, ואיך לשלב את המתאם וה-Vungle SDK באפליקציהFlutter .

שילובים נתמכים ופורמטים נתמכים של מודעות

שילוב
בידינג
מפל
פורמטים
מודעות בפתיחת האפליקציה 1, 3
כרזה 2
פרסומת מרווח ביניים
ההטבה הופעלה
מודעת מעברון מתגמלת 2

1 השילוב של הבידינג בפורמט הזה הוא בגרסת בטא סגורה.

2 השילוב של בידינג בפורמט הזה הוא בגרסת בטא פתוחה.

3 השילוב של Waterfall בפורמט הזה הוא בגרסת בטא סגורה.

דרישות

  • ה-SDK העדכני של מודעות Google לנייד
  • Flutter 3.7.0 ואילך
  • כדי לפרוס ב-Android
    • Android API ברמת 21 ואילך
  • כדי לפרוס ב-iOS
    • יעד הפריסה של iOS הוא 12.0 ומעלה
  • פרויקט Flutter עבודה שמוגדר באמצעות Google Mobile Ads SDK. פרטים נוספים זמינים במאמר תחילת העבודה.
  • משלימים את ההוראות של תהליך בחירת הרשת (Mediation) המדריך לתחילת העבודה

שלב 1: הגדרת הגדרות בממשק המשתמש של Liftoff Monetize

נרשמים או מתחברים לחשבון Liftoff Monetize.

מוסיפים את האפליקציה למרכז הבקרה של Liftoff Monetize בלחיצה על הלחצן Add Application (הוספת אפליקציה).

ממלאים את הטופס ומזינים את כל הפרטים הנדרשים.

Android

iOS

אחרי שיוצרים את האפליקציה, בוחרים אותה ממרכז הבקרה של Liftoff Monetize.

Android

iOS

חשוב לשים לב למזהה האפליקציה.

Android

iOS

הוספה של מיקומי מודעות חדשים

כדי ליצור מיקום מודעה חדש לשימוש עם AdMob תהליך בחירת הרשת, נכנסים אל מרכז הבקרה של Liftoff Monetize, לוחצים על Add Placement ובוחרים את האפליקציה מהרשימה הנפתחת.

פרטים על הוספת מיקומים חדשים מופיעים בהמשך:

מודעות בפתיחת האפליקציה

בוחרים באפשרות מעברון ומזינים שם של מיקום מודעה. לאחר מכן, בוחרים באפשרות כן בשדה ניתנת לדילוג וממלאים את שאר הטופס. [בידינג בלבד] בקטע מונטיזציה, מעבירים את בידינג בתוך האפליקציה למצב מופעל. לחץ על הלחצן Continue (המשך) בתחתית הדף על מנת ליצור את המיקום.

לוחצים על Banner, מזינים שם של מיקום וממלאים את שאר הטופס. [בידינג בלבד] בקטע מונטיזציה, מעבירים את המתג בידינג בתוך האפליקציה למצב מופעל. לחץ על הלחצן Continue (המשך) בתחתית הדף על מנת ליצור את מיקום המודעה.

מודעת באנר 300x250

בוחרים באפשרות MREC, מזינים שם מיקום וממלאים את שאר הטופס. [בידינג בלבד] בקטע מונטיזציה, מעבירים את המתג בידינג בתוך האפליקציה למצב מופעל. לחץ על הלחצן Continue (המשך) בתחתית הדף על מנת ליצור את מיקום המודעה.

פרסומת מרווח ביניים

בוחרים באפשרות מעברון, מזינים שם מיקום וממלאים את שאר הטופס. [בידינג בלבד] בקטע מונטיזציה, מעבירים את המתג בידינג בתוך האפליקציה למצב מופעל. לחץ על הלחצן Continue (המשך) בתחתית הדף על מנת ליצור את מיקום המודעה.

ההטבה הופעלה

בוחרים באפשרות מתגמלת, מזינים שם מיקום וממלאים את שאר הטופס. [בידינג בלבד] בקטע מונטיזציה, מעבירים את המתג בידינג בתוך האפליקציה למצב מופעל. לחץ על הלחצן Continue (המשך) בתחתית הדף על מנת ליצור את מיקום המודעה.

מודעת מעברון מתגמלת

בוחרים באפשרות מתגמלת. מזינים שם מיקום, מפעילים את האפשרות ניתנת לדילוג וממלאים את שאר הטופס. [בידינג בלבד] בקטע מונטיזציה, מעבירים את בידינג בתוך האפליקציה למצב מופעל. לחץ על הלחצן Continue (המשך) בתחתית הדף על מנת ליצור את מיקום המודעה.

מותאם

בוחרים באפשרות Native, מזינים שם מיקום וממלאים את שאר הטופס. [בידינג בלבד] בקטע מונטיזציה, מעבירים את המתג בידינג בתוך האפליקציה למצב מופעל. לחץ על הלחצן Continue (המשך) בתחתית הדף על מנת ליצור את מיקום המודעה.

מציינים את מזהה ההפניה ולוחצים על צלילים טובים.

מודעות בפתיחת האפליקציה

מודעת באנר 300x250

פרסומת מרווח ביניים

ההטבה הופעלה

מודעת מעברון מתגמלת

מותאם

איתור מפתח ה-Reporting API

בידינג

לא צריך לבצע את השלב הזה בשילובי בידינג.

מפל

בנוסף למזהה האפליקציה ולמזהה ההפניה, תצטרכו גם את מפתח ה-Reporting API של Liftoff Monetize כדי להגדיר אתAdMob המזהה של יחידת המודעות. נכנסים למרכז הבקרה של Liftoff Monetize Reports ולוחצים על Reporting API Key כדי להציג את מפתח Reporting API.

הפעלת מצב בדיקה

כדי להפעיל מודעות בדיקה, נכנסים למרכז הבקרה של Liftoff Monetize ועוברים לקטע Applications (אפליקציות).

בקטע מזהה מיקום באפליקציה בוחרים את האפליקציה שבה רוצים להפעיל את מודעות הבדיקה. בקטע סטטוס בוחרים באפשרות מצב בדיקה כדי להפעיל את מודעות הבדיקה.

Android

iOS

שלב 2: מגדירים את Liftoff Monetize AdMob בממשק המשתמש

קביעת הגדרות של תהליך בחירת הרשת (Mediation) ביחידת המודעות

Android

לקבלת הוראות, עיינו בשלב 2 במדריך עבור Android.

iOS

לקבלת הוראות, עיינו בשלב 2 במדריך iOS.

הוספה של Liftoff לרשימת שותפי הפרסום של תקנות GDPR ותקנות במדינות בארה"ב

פועלים לפי השלבים המפורטים בקטע הגדרות GDPR וגם הגדרות של תקנות במדינות בארה"ב כדי להוסיף את Liftoff לרשימת שותפי הפרסום לתקנות GDPR ומדינות בארה"ב בממשק המשתמש AdMob .

שלב 3: מייבאים את Vungle SDK ואת המתאם Liftoff Monetize

שילוב דרך pub.dev

מוסיפים את יחסי התלות הבאים עם הגרסאות העדכניות שלLiftoff Monetize ה-SDK והמתאם בקובץ pubspec.yaml של החבילה:

dependencies:
  gma_mediation_liftoffmonetize: ^1.0.0

שילוב ידני

הורד את הגרסה האחרונה של פלאגין הגישור של Google Mobile Ads עבור Liftoff Monetize, מחלצים את הקובץ שהורדתם ומוסיפים את תיקיית הפלאגין שחולצה (ואת התוכן שלה) לפרויקט Flutter שלכם. לאחר מכן, מוסיפים את התלות הבאה לפלאגין בקובץ pubspec.yaml:

dependencies:
  gma_mediation_liftoffmonetize:
    path: path/to/local/package

שלב 4: מטמיעים את הגדרות הפרטיות ב-Liftoff Monetize SDK

בהתאם למדיניות Google בנושא הסכמת משתמשים באיחוד האירופי, עליכם לוודא שהודעות גילוי נאות מסוימות נמסרות למשתמשים באזור הכלכלי האירופי (EEA) בנוגע לשימוש במזהי מכשירים ובמידע אישי, ושהם מקובלים עליכם. המדיניות הזו משקפת את הדרישות שמפורטות ב-ePrivacy Directive (ההנחיה בנושא פרטיות ותקשורת אלקטרונית) וב-General Data Protection Regulation (התקנה הכללית להגנה על מידע, GDPR) של האיחוד האירופי. כשמבקשים הסכמה, צריך לזהות כל רשת מודעות בשרשרת לבחירת הרשת שעשויה לאסוף מידע אישי, לקבל אותו או להשתמש בו, ולספק מידע על השימוש בכל רשת. בשלב זה Google לא יכולה להעביר את בחירת המשתמש לגבי הסכמה לרשתות כאלה באופן אוטומטי.

הפלאגין של תהליך בחירת הרשת (Mediation) ב-Google Mobile Ads עבור Liftoff Monetize כולל את השיטה GmaMediationLiftoffmonetize.setGDPRStatus(). הקוד לדוגמה הבא מראה איך להעביר את פרטי ההסכמה ל-Vungle SDK. אם תבחרו לקרוא לשיטה הזו, מומלץ לקרוא לה לפני שתבקשו מודעות דרך Google Mobile Ads SDK.

import 'package:gma_mediation_liftoffmonetize/gma_mediation_liftoffmonetize.dart';
// ...

GmaMediationLiftoffmonetize.setGDPRStatus(true, "1.0.0");

לקבלת פרטים נוספים ולערכים שאפשר לציין בשיטה, עיינו בהוראות ההטמעה המומלצות ל-Android ול-iOS.

חוקי פרטיות במדינות בארה"ב

חוקי פרטיות במדינות בארה"ב דורשים למשתמשים את הזכות לא להסכים ל'מכירה' של 'המידע האישי' שלהם (כפי שהחוק מגדיר את המונחים האלה). אפשרות ביטול ההסכמה מוצעת באמצעות קישור בולט בשם 'Do Not Sell My Personal Information' (אל תמכרו את המידע האישי שלי) בדף הבית של הצד המוֹכֵר. במדריך לתאימות לחוקי הפרטיות במדינות ארה"ב אפשר להפעיל עיבוד נתונים מוגבל של הצגת המודעות ב-Google, אבל Google לא יכולה להחיל את ההגדרה הזו על כל רשת מודעות בשרשרת לבחירת הרשת. לכן, צריך לזהות כל רשת מודעות בשרשרת לבחירת רשת שעשוית להשתתף במכירה של מידע אישי, ולפעול בהתאם להנחיות של כל אחת מהרשתות האלה כדי לוודא שהן עומדות בדרישות.

הפלאגין של תהליך בחירת הרשת (Mediation) ב-Google Mobile Ads עבור Liftoff Monetize כולל את השיטה GmaMediationLiftoffmonetize.setCCPAStatus(). הקוד לדוגמה הבא מראה איך להעביר את פרטי ההסכמה ל-Vungle SDK. אם תבחרו לקרוא לשיטה הזו, מומלץ לקרוא לה לפני שתבקשו מודעות דרך Google Mobile Ads SDK.

import 'package:gma_mediation_liftoffmonetize/gma_mediation_liftoffmonetize.dart';
// ...

GmaMediationLiftoffmonetize.setCCPAStatus(true);

לקבלת פרטים נוספים ולערכים שאפשר לספק ב-method, עיינו בהוראות ההטמעה המומלצות ל-Android ול-iOS.

שלב 5: מוסיפים את קוד החובה

Android

לא נדרש קוד נוסף בשילוב של Liftoff Monetize.

iOS

שילוב של SKAdNetwork

פועלים לפי מסמכי התיעוד של Liftoff Monetize כדי להוסיף את מזהי SKAdNetwork לקובץ Info.plist של הפרויקט.

שלב 6: בודקים את ההטמעה

הפעלת מודעות בדיקה

חשוב לרשום את מכשיר הבדיקה ל- AdMob ולהפעיל את מצב הבדיקה ב Liftoff Monetize ממשק המשתמש.

אימות מודעות בדיקה

כדי לוודא שמוצגות לך מודעות לבדיקה מ-Liftoff Monetize, צריך להפעיל בדיקה של מקור מודעות יחיד בכלי לבדיקת מודעות באמצעות Liftoff Monetize (Bidding) and Liftoff Monetize (Waterfall) מקורות המודעות.

קודי שגיאה

אם המתאם לא מצליח לקבל מודעה מ-Liftoff Monetize, בעלי האפליקציות יכולים לבדוק את השגיאה הבסיסית בתגובה למודעה באמצעות ResponseInfo במחלקות הבאות:

iOS

פורמט שם הכיתה
כרזה GADMAdapterVungleInterstitial
פרסומת מרווח ביניים GADMAdapterVungleInterstitial
ההטבה הופעלה GADMAdapterVungleRewardbasedVideoAd

ריכזנו כאן את הקודים וההודעות הנלוות שהתקבלו מהמתאם של Liftoff Monetize כשטעינת מודעה נכשלת:

iOS

קוד שגיאה הסיבה
1-100 Vungle SDK החזיר שגיאה. לפרטים נוספים, ראו קוד.
101 הפרמטרים של השרת של Liftoff Monetize שהוגדרו AdMob בממשק המשתמש חסרים/לא תקינים.
102 כבר נטענה מודעה עבור תצורת הרשת הזו. ב-Vungle SDK לא ניתן לטעון מודעה שנייה עבור אותו מזהה מיקום מודעה.
103 גודל המודעה המבוקש לא תואם לגודל מודעת באנר שנתמך על ידי Liftoff Monetize.
104 ב-Vungle SDK לא הייתה אפשרות לעבד את מודעת הבאנר.
105 Vungle SDK תומך בטעינה של מודעת באנר אחת בלבד בכל פעם, ללא קשר למזהה המיקום.
106 Vungle SDK שלח קריאה חוזרת (callback) שלפיה לא ניתן להפעיל את המודעה.

יומן שינויים של מתאם תהליך בחירת הרשת (Mediation) ב-Liftoff Monetize

גרסה 1.0.0

  • גרסה ראשונית.
  • תאימות מאומתת עם מתאם Android Liftoff Monetize גרסה 7.3.1.0
  • תאימות מאומתת עם מתאם LiftoffMonetize גרסה 7.3.2.0 של מתאם iOS
  • התוסף נוצר ונבדק עם Google Mobile Ads Flutter גרסה 5.1.0.